#358a12 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#358a12 is composed of 20.8% red, 54.1%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 87% yellow and 45.9% black. It has a hue angle of 102.5 degrees, a saturation of 76.9% and a lightness of 30.6%. #358a12 color hex could be obtained by blending #6aff24 with #001500.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#358a12 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#358a12 has RGB values of R:53, G:138,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.87,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 3508754.

Shades and Tints of #358a12
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#061102 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#358a12
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e4e4e is the less saturated color, while #309606 is the most saturated one.
